speaking when youre angry; regretting what you're saying

by Nanette Bellman

fumbling forwards and bumbling backwards
tongue tied by the blind side
of practicing the pronunciation
and altering the alliteration
making faces in the mirror
while clarifying what needs clearer
to perfect the perfect speech
that a person could possibly speak
but the brainwaves just go blank
when the moment's come to make
the special delivery of the day
of saying what you've got to say
living like there's nothing left
repeating what one could regret
            .....because you just told me to go fuck myself

01/11/2008

Author's Note: “Speak when you are angry - and you'll make the best speech you'll ever regret.” - Dr. Laurence J. Peters
